WebJul 14, 2024 · The proteolytic enzymes, such as trypsin and chymotrypsin are very powerful molecules and will attack any protein- including the protein of the pancreas itself. This problem has been neatly resolved in the acinar cells, which produce the various proteolytic enzymes in their inactive or precursor forms. WebAug 21, 2024 · An inactive enzyme that must be activated by another enzyme is called a zymogen. The zymogen trypsinogen remains inactive to prevent any cleaving from happening in the pancreas. WebApr 30, 2015 · The inactive form of trypsin is known as trypsinogen. The inactivity is vital, since proteins are very important components of cells.
